Leaving Vehicle Unattended With Engine Running (Misdemeanor)
- Statutory Authority. | Okla. Stat. tit. 47, § 11-1101.

The person driving or in charge of a motor vehicle shall not permit it to stand unattended without first stopping the engine, and effectively setting the brake thereon and, when standing upon any grade, turning the front wheels to the curb or side of the highway.
